If you are going to buy a new graphics card and are choosing between Radeon 540 and Radeon RX 570, there are a couple of things to consider. Cards with more VRAM in general perform better and allow you to play on higher graphics settings. Size also makes a difference. A model with a large heatsink can occupy up to three expansion slots on a motherboard. Be sure you have enough room in your PC case. When comparing GPUs with different architectures, more processing cores and even higher TFLOPS will not always translate to better performance.   • Radeon RX 570 has 140% more power consumption, than Radeon 540.
  • Radeon 540 is connected by PCIe 3.0 x8, and Radeon RX 570 uses PCIe 3.0 x16 interface.
  • Radeon RX 570 has 6 GB more memory, than Radeon 540.
  • Both cards are used in Desktops.
  • Radeon 540 is build with GCN 4.0 architecture, and Radeon RX 570 - with Polaris.
  • Core clock speed of Radeon RX 570 is 68 MHz higher, than Radeon 540.
  • Radeon 540 and Radeon RX 570 are manufactured by 14 nm process technology.
  • Radeon RX 570 is 96 mm longer, than Radeon 540.
  • Memory clock speed of Radeon 540 and Radeon RX 570 is 7000 MHz.
